Subject: cgroup null pointer dereference 

Hello,

While running IOs to an nvme fabrics target we're hitting this null pointer which causes 
CPU hard lockups and NMI. Before the lockups, the Medusa IOs ran successfully for ~23 hours.

I did not find any panics listing nvme or block driver calls.

RIP: 0010:cgroup_rstat_flush+0x1d0/0x750
points to rstat.c, cgroup_rstat_push_children(), line 162 under second while() to the following code.

160                 /* updated_next is parent cgroup terminated */
161                 while (child != parent) {
162                         child->rstat_flush_next = head;
163                         head = child;
164                         crstatc = cgroup_rstat_cpu(child, cpu);
165                         grandchild = crstatc->updated_children;

In my test env I've added a null check to 'child' and re-running the long-term test.
I'm wondering if this patch is sufficient to address any underlying issue or is just a band-aid.
Please share any known patches or suggestions.
             -          while (child != parent) {
             +         while (child && child != parent) {

Reference: git://git.infradead.org/nvme.git tags/nvme-6.15-2025-04-10
